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
632630679 925254 0825
6730801 547008122
6730801 547008122
396 193 49762289
All about undefined
Interested in learning more?
6730801 547008122
396 193 49762289
See more
133 76831409
47589 10126224129 178387 759 8739726564
See more
75828604255 9239822458
9109633 67 029 21975 043
See more